Does Heat Make Hair Colour Fade?

Hair colour fading is complicated.

Washing, UV exposure, the type of colour used, hair porosity and the condition of the hair can all influence how quickly salon colour changes.

Heat adds another factor to the equation.

A scientific study examining permanent and semi-permanent hair colourants found that prolonged exposure to 220°C altered the chemical structure of the colourants tested.

Research into heat exposure and coloured hair therefore provides direct evidence that sufficiently intense thermal exposure can affect chemical hair dyes.

But there's an important distinction.

A straightener operating at very high temperatures is not the same as a hair dryer operating at a much lower temperature.

Temperature, exposure time and frequency all matter.

What Happens to Hair When It Gets Too Hot?

Hair is remarkably strong, but it isn't indestructible.

Repeated or excessive thermal exposure can affect the structure and surface of the hair fibre.

A study comparing different blow-drying conditions examined hair dried at approximately 47°C, 61°C and 95°C.

The result?

Surface damage tended to increase as temperature increased.

You can read the study on hair-dryer temperature and hair shaft damage published in Annals of Dermatology.

This gives us one of the most important lessons for coloured hair:

More heat isn't automatically better.

If hair can be dried effectively without exposing it to unnecessarily high temperatures, there's little reason to simply maximise the heat.

Why Hair Condition Matters for Colour

There's another part of this conversation that is often overlooked.

Colour isn't only about pigment.

It's also about how the hair looks.

Freshly coloured salon hair usually looks incredibly vibrant partly because it is smooth, glossy and reflects light beautifully.

When the surface of the hair becomes rougher or damaged, light reflection changes.

The colour may therefore appear:

  • duller,
  • less glossy,
  • less dimensional,
  • less vibrant.

This means protecting coloured hair isn't only about trying to keep colour molecules inside the hair.

It's also about maintaining the condition and appearance of the hair itself.

Healthy-looking shine makes colour look better.

Hair Dryer vs Straightener: Heat Isn't Always the Same

It's easy to put every heated styling tool into the same category.

But that's misleading.

A straightener can operate at temperatures approaching or exceeding 200°C, while a hair dryer typically exposes hair to considerably lower temperatures.

The way heat reaches the hair is different too.

Straighteners and curling irons create direct contact between a hot surface and the hair.

A hair dryer uses heated airflow.

This means the important question isn't simply:

“Do you use heat?”

A better question is:

“How much heat does your hair experience, for how long and how often?”

The study examining chemical hair dyes at 220°C demonstrates that intense heat can alter colourants, while research into blow-drying shows increasing surface damage with increasing drying temperatures.

Is Blow-Drying Bad for Coloured Hair?

Not necessarily.

In fact, research suggests the answer is much more interesting than that.

In the study comparing different hair-drying methods, researchers compared natural drying with several blow-drying temperatures and distances.

Hair surfaces showed progressively more damage as temperature increased.

But the researchers also found that using a hair dryer at approximately 15 cm distance with continuous movement caused less damage than natural drying under the experimental conditions.

So the conclusion shouldn't be:

“Never blow-dry coloured hair.”

It should be:

“Pay attention to how you blow-dry coloured hair.”

Temperature matters.

Distance matters.

Drying time matters.

Technique matters.

And the dryer itself matters.

What Temperature Should You Use on Coloured Hair?

There isn't one perfect temperature for every person.

Hair thickness, texture, condition, porosity and the amount of water in the hair can all influence the drying process.

But there is a useful general principle:

Use the lowest effective temperature that achieves the result you need.

Fine, fragile, bleached or highly processed hair may benefit from a gentler approach.

Thicker or denser hair may require different airflow and temperature settings.

The important thing is having control rather than relying on maximum heat every time you dry.

How to Protect Coloured Hair From Heat

You don't need to stop using your favourite styling tools.

Instead, build a smarter heat routine.

1. Use Heat Protection

Use an appropriate heat-protection product before exposing hair to heated styling tools.

2. Don't Automatically Choose Maximum Heat

Higher temperatures aren't necessary for every hair type or every styling session.

Start lower and increase only when needed.

3. Keep Your Hair Dryer Moving

Avoid concentrating hot airflow on one small section of hair for unnecessarily long periods.

4. Maintain Some Distance

Research into blow-drying highlights the importance of both temperature and distance.

Avoid pressing the dryer directly against the hair.

5. Reduce Repeated Heat Where Possible

If you've already blow-dried your hair into the style you want, ask whether you really need another complete pass with a straightener.

6. Pay Extra Attention to Bleached or Highly Processed Hair

Hair that has undergone significant chemical processing may require a gentler approach.

7. Choose a Dryer With Good Temperature Control

A dryer should give you the ability to adapt heat and airflow to your hair rather than forcing you into one high-temperature setting.

Frequently Asked Questions About Heat and Coloured Hair

Does heat make dyed hair fade faster?

Extreme heat can affect coloured hair.

Research has shown that prolonged exposure at 220°C can alter the chemical structure of permanent and semi-permanent colourants tested in laboratory conditions.

That doesn't mean every use of a hair dryer will noticeably fade your colour.

Temperature, duration, frequency, colouring method and hair condition all matter.

Is 200°C too hot for coloured hair?

There isn't one universal maximum temperature suitable for every person's hair.

However, 200°C represents very high thermal exposure, particularly for hair that is bleached, fragile or heavily processed.

Use the lowest effective temperature for your hair and styling goal and follow the instructions for your styling tool and heat-protection product.

Does blow-drying damage coloured hair?

Blow-drying isn't automatically damaging.

Research found that surface damage increased with temperature, demonstrating why technique and temperature control matter.

Interestingly, one experimental study found that drying at a distance of 15 cm with continuous movement resulted in less damage than natural drying under the conditions tested.

Read the full hair-drying study.

Is air-drying better than blow-drying?

Not necessarily.

Air-drying removes thermal exposure, but that doesn't automatically mean it is always the least damaging option.

The study discussed above found damage to the cell membrane complex only in the naturally dried group, while controlled blow-drying at a distance produced less overall damage under the experimental conditions.

The key takeaway is that gentle, controlled drying matters more than simplistic rules about never using a dryer.
